Chemistry : experiment and theory / Bernice G. Segal.

By: Segal, Bernice G.
Material type: materialTypeLabelBookPublisher: New York : Wiley, c1989Edition: 2nd ed.Description: xxiv, 1008 p. : ill. ; 26 cm. + pbk.ISBN: 0471504092.Subject(s): ChemistryDDC classification: 540
Contents:
Atomic structure and stoichiometry -- Introduction to the periodic table, some families of elements and inorganic nomenclature -- The gas laws and stoichiometry involving gases -- The properties of gases and the kinetic molecular theory -- Intermolecular forces, condenses phases and changes of phase -- Properties of dilute solutions -- Aqueous solutions and ionic reactions -- Introduction to the law of chemical equilibrium -- Acids, bases and salts -- Buffer solutions and acid base titrations -- Equilibria involving slightly soluble electrolytes -- Atomic structure, atomic spectra and the introduction of the quantum concept -- The electronic structure of atoms, the periodic table and periodic properties -- The nature of the chemical bond -- Oxidation states and oxidation reduction reactions -- Energy ,enthalpy and thermochemistry -- Entropy free energy and equilibrium -- Electrochemistry -- Chemical kinetics -- Coordination compounds -- Properties and structures of metallic and ionic crystalline solids -- Radioactivity and nuclear chemistry -- Introduction to organic chemistry.
